Maa Kamakhya Temple: Women Veil Themselves, Pray for Hours at 700-Year-Old Purnia Shrine
- •Women observed the Thadi Vrat fair at the 700-year-old Maa Kamakhya Temple in Majra Panchayat, Purnia.
- •Devotees, numbering over 200,000, gathered at the temple, known for its historical significance and strong beliefs.
- •Women sat veiled for hours, fasting and praying without food or drink, seeking fulfillment of various wishes.
- •Offerings of fruits, flowers, and sweets were made to Maa Kamakhya, with women hoping for divine grace.
- •Many women expressed belief that their wishes would be granted and pledged to observe the fast again next year.
Why It Matters: Devotees, especially women, observe the ancient Thadi Vrat at the 700-year-old Maa Kamakhya Temple in Purnia for wish fulfillment.
